Wrexham 'should have beaten billionaire Chelsea' - Parkinson
Briefly

Phil Parkinson emphasized the impressive performance of his team against Chelsea, stating, 'You've got to put it into context. We've played a billion-pound team...To go toe-to-toe with Chelsea tonight, you can understand what an effort that was from the lads and we could and should have won the game.'
Parkinson praised his players' dedication and adaptability, stating, 'The new players have come in and slotted in really well for us so far. It was a proper shift from our boys and we played with belief in the second period and really took the game to them.'
